哪些网站是响应式的,企业建设网站注意点,2023企业所得税300万以上,下载应用市场软件一、请回望暑假时的第一次作业#xff0c;你对于软件工程课程的想象 1#xff09;对比开篇博客你对课程目标和期待#xff0c;“希望通过实践锻炼#xff0c;增强计算机专业的能力和就业竞争力”#xff0c;对比目前的所学所练所得#xff0c;在哪些方面达到了你的期待和…一、请回望暑假时的第一次作业你对于软件工程课程的想象 1对比开篇博客你对课程目标和期待“希望通过实践锻炼增强计算机专业的能力和就业竞争力”对比目前的所学所练所得在哪些方面达到了你的期待和目标哪些方面还存在哪些不足为什么 达成的目标和期待 进行了团队协作开发。 结识了新朋友。 学习了新的编程语言。 对自己进行了规范编程的训练。 熟悉了新的框架。 学习使用了许多新的开发工具和平台。 文档的书写能力有了提高 对于软件开发有了更深刻的认识。 了解了搜索引擎和中文分词 存在的不足 项目有了一定经验对于实际场景后台的高并发并没有涉及。 UML等相关工具的使用只是体验式的缺乏深入学习。 在项目代码管理做的不是很好github不是熟练。 2总结这门课程的实践总结和给你带来的提升 关于代码量——PHP:1200行左右C500行左右。 团队合作中我学会了很多互相交流代码风格得到了规范。 学习和使用的新软件 学习和使用的新工具 学习和掌握的新语言、新平台 学习和掌握的新方法 其他方面的提升 有思维导图福昕阅读器 Navicat PremiumPhpStormWampserver64 PHP,GitHub,sphinx 学习和使用coreseek进行站内搜索学习使用ThinkPHP5.0框架,学习使用phpExcel框架 二、写下属于自己的人月神话——个人或结对或团队项目实践中的经验总结实例/例证结合的分析 关于进度发现很多时候会发生后期进度来不及的情况而这会导致软件质量无法得到保证甚至没法完成。所以我们要避免这种情况首先在项目之初就应该结合自身团队和资源情况全面考虑工作内容和进度安排并留出最后一部分时间用于弹性安排。第二点是其实很多进度来不及是因为总是把工作放在最后总是拖拉拖欠工作量。所以队友和队友之间要发挥好互相督促作用把每一阶段的工作在指定的时间内完成。 关于代码规范在软件开发过程中一个团队一定要有一套统一的代码规范混乱的代码风格会使平常工作的代码整合工作异常艰难同时给代码的维护和运行埋下很多隐患。我们又如何去解决这个问题呢我们首先要统一一套代码规范并且善用GitHub工具在日常工作中就时时整合代码队友之间互相监督代码规范的实施。 三、对下一届实践的建议或者对于开学初的你对于大一的你对于开学初的我你有什么想建议和告知的呢对于后来人的期许。 特别地特别地下一届要不要中途换队员 对于下一届的告知与建议我觉得大家一定要选择一个自己喜欢的题目这样我们才能坚持完成它而不容易半途而废。 关于要不要中途换队员这个问题我的意见是换。其实如果有同学在像这个问题说明队伍已经出现了很糟糕的情况。但是我觉得想换队友的话必须弄清楚发生的问题的原因并了解其他队伍的情况想好自己在新的团队中又应该以何种角色存在、可以做出什么贡献。不要一换再换。 四、分析一下自己所处的团队。软件工程实践是大学里少有的认真的团队协作经验。《构建之法》上说团队的发展有几个阶段你的团队都经历过么最后到达了“创造”阶段了么参考《构建执法》第17章 人、绩效和职业道德 第一阶段其实团队里的同学是自己班级互相了解的同学和兄弟班的几个同学。虽然不是很熟悉但是在思考选题的过程中大家积极的发表意见交流地很激烈。这是我们地破冰仪式这之后大家初步建立起了团队、并安排分工。 第二阶段在明确了目标、分工后正式进入了协助完成作业阶段 第三阶段在正式开发期间我们遇到的问题最多一边学习一边开发。一起讨论需求和个版本地完成虽然很难但是在队友的一起努力下我们都克服了。 五、怎样证明你学会了软件工程 1研发出符合用户需求的软件 必须公开发布有实际的用户一定的用户量和持续使用量 3 天后能保持10 - 100个用户而不是: 做没有用户使用的软件 在软件开发前需要做好产品针对的群体定位提出需求并调查其是否确实存在。根据问卷结果分析我们软件所要完成的功能是符合用户需求的。 在选题答辩环节中接受老师和同学们的建议指出了我们产品设计的一些痛点我们也在积极地思考。 2通过一系列工具流程团队合作能够在预计的时间内发布 “足够好” 的软件 有项目规划/需求/设计/实现/发布/维护有定时的进度发布 而不是: 通过临时熬夜胡乱拼凑大牛一人代劳延迟交付等方式糊弄 我主要做的是后端部分功能的实现我就说说后端的情况。在整个项目期间我们先完成了api文档以api的个数来确定工作量大小。根据耦合度高低将api分成几个部分由不同队友完成。 在alpha版本和bate版本进度汇报中我们均有展示每个队友在这个项目中的代码量没有一个人是闲着的。 3并且通过数据展现软件是可以维护和继续发展的。 而不是 找不到源代码代码无文档代码不能编译没有task/bug 等项目的发展资料 在此贴出编码期间产生的后端部分api文档图片 转载于:https://www.cnblogs.com/bsyt/p/8232372.html